Finally, it happened!
It was Tuesday(Aug 2, 2K11) morning. The noises(filled with excitement as well as nervousness) from my brother's room woke me up. I got up from the bed and went to his room.
Oh my God! ... few things were scattered on the carpet while the others were peeping out from the suitcases and few others from his cupboard. Oh yes! he was supposed to catch a flight (whose departure was at 11:25 p.m the same night) . So, he had to report at 8:30 p.m at the airport and obviously, we all were struck in doing the last minute preparations. A couple of hours later, everything settled and we were supposed to get the bags and suitcases, weighed.
Well well well... it wasn't a surprise to find that the luggage was definitely overweight. It was 4 p.m. now when all of us started removing the unnecessary things which took us another couple of hours. The clock was undoubtedly moving faster now. The time flew in blink of an eye. Finally we all left at 7 p. m.
We reached the airport at 7:5o p.m. While we were on our way, my brother was busy in saying " thank you's " to the numerous " Best Wishes Calls " from relatives and friends. And it was the time to say "goodbye". As he entered through Gate number 2, he started walking towards the end of Gate number 5, we followed him, walking parallel outside(visitors or rather people other than their customers), where he stood in the queue to get his luggage weighed. We were moving by a few centimeters to catch his glimpse then, as he was moving forward with the queue. After about 20 minutes he went inside and now, was out of our sight. We saw people hugging, kissing, exchanging "miss u yaar" talks, a few of them crying as well. Even I could feel my eyes being filled up with tears. But, I controlled my emotions because if I wouldn't have controlled then, I wouldn't have been able to control later as well.
Ah! we found a vacant bench. We checked the departure time again on the screen. It flashed 11:25 p.m. Singapore Airlines H (block)
Brother called and told us that he has been declared clear and can board his flight. And, we left for home.
After reaching at 10 p.m., we had dinner and watched TV. One of my cousins paid a visit as my grandmother was alone at home. We had a "gupshup" (chitchat) session for about an hour or so. when "he" called up to inform that he had boarded the flight and was now switching off his cell phone. Mumma gave him numerous instructions and we all did the same as per our turn of talking to him. Finally, we exchanged final goodbyes for one-and-a-half days.
One-and-a-half days later, we got a call from him, informing us that he had reached safe and sound. Phew... this Tuesday is the longest day of my life and the most memorable one as well. Lifting 23+ Kg suitcases isn't a joke after all.
